Repointing in Cleveland, OH
Repointing services involve the careful process of renewing the mortar joints between bricks, stones, or other masonry materials on a property’s exterior or interior walls. This work is essential for maintaining the structural integrity and appearance of brickwork, especially on older or weathered buildings. Projects typically include repairing or replacing deteriorated mortar in walls, chimneys, or decorative facades, helping to prevent water infiltration, reduce damage from freeze-thaw cycles, and restore the visual appeal of the masonry. Property owners often seek repointing when noticing crumbling mortar, cracks, or signs of wear that could compromise the stability or aesthetic of their property.
Before requesting repointing services, homeowners should understand the scope of the work needed, including the extent of mortar deterioration and the type of mortar suitable for their specific masonry. It is also helpful to consider the age and condition of the existing mortar, as well as any underlying issues such as moisture intrusion or structural movement. Proper preparation and assessment ensure that the repointing process effectively preserves the masonry’s durability and appearance, making it a valuable step in maintaining the long-term health of a property’s brickwork.

Repointing Questions
What is repointing? Repointing involves renewing the external mortar joints between bricks or stones to improve stability and appearance.
When should repointing be considered? Repointing is recommended when mortar shows signs of cracking, crumbling, or weathering, affecting the wall’s integrity.
What types of projects often require repointing? Repointing is common on historic brick facades, garden walls, and any masonry that has experienced mortar deterioration.
How does repointing benefit a property? Repointing helps protect against water infiltration, prevents structural damage, and enhances curb appeal.
